Magentic attraction is the powerful force behind our world. It is the force that governs the behavior of magnets, and it is also the force that shapes the universe around us. Without magnetism, our world would be a very different place. Let us explore the wonders of magnetic attraction and its impact on our lives.

Magnetism is a fundamental force of nature, just like gravity and electromagnetism. It is the force that attracts or repels magnetic materials, such as iron, nickel, and cobalt. Magnetism arises from the movement of electric charges. Every atom consists of electrons orbiting around a nucleus. Electrons possess an intrinsic property of spin, which generates a tiny magnetic field. In most materials, the magnetic fields of individual atoms cancel each other out due to random orientation. However, in certain materials, such as iron, nickel, and cobalt, the magnetic fields of atoms align with each other, creating a net magnetic moment that adds up to a macroscopic magnetic field.

Magnetic fields can exert a force on other magnetic fields. When two magnets are brought close together, their magnetic fields interact with each other. If the magnetic poles are opposite, i.e., a north pole and a south pole, then the magnets will attract each other. If the magnetic poles are the same, i.e., two north poles or two south poles, then the magnets will repel each other. The strength of the attraction or repulsion depends on the distance between the magnets, the size of the magnets, and the strength of their magnetic fields.

Magnetic attraction has many practical applications in our daily lives. One of the most visible applications is in the form of refrigerator magnets. These are small magnets that stick to the surface of a refrigerator or other metallic objects. They are used to hold reminders, notes, and photographs. Another common application is in electric motors and generators. These devices use magnetic fields to convert electrical energy into mechanical energy or vice versa. For example, an electric motor has a rotating shaft that is surrounded by a magnetic field. When electric current flows through the coils around the shaft, it produces a magnetic field that interacts with the energy of the magnetic field around the shaft, causing the shaft to rotate. Similarly, a generator works in reverse, converting mechanical energy into electrical energy.

Magnetic attraction also plays a crucial role in the Earth's magnetic field. The Earth behaves like a giant magnet, with its magnetic north pole located near the geographic north pole. The magnetic field of the Earth is generated by the motion of liquid iron in the core of the Earth. The Earth's magnetic field creates a protective shield around the planet, deflecting harmful solar radiation and cosmic rays. It also provides a directional reference for navigation, as compasses align with the magnetic field of the Earth.

Beyond the Earth, magnetic attraction shapes the behavior of cosmic objects. The Sun, for example, has a powerful magnetic field that varies in strength and direction over time. This variability is related to the Sun's activity cycle, which affects the emission of solar particles and the formation of sunspots. The solar wind, a stream of charged particles from the Sun, interacts with the magnetic field of the Earth, causing auroras in the polar regions. The study of the magnetic fields of stars, planets, and galaxies is a vibrant area of research that sheds light on the complex dynamics of the universe.
